Flex中如何通过dataTipOffset样式设置HSlider控件的数据开销的例子

By Minidxer | May 10, 2008

Flex中如何将HSlider控件作为DataGrid列中的一个项目的例子一样,还是关于HSlider的例子。

接下来的例子中,演示了如何通过dataTipOffset样式,设置HSlider控件的数据开销,也就是当前滑标所占的数据情况。

让我们先来看一下Demo(可以右键View Source或点击这里察看源代码


下面是完整代码(或点击这里查看):

Download: main.mxml
  1. <?xml version="1.0" encoding="utf-8"?>
  2. <mx:Application xmlns:mx="http://www.adobe.com/2006/mxml"
  3.         layout="vertical"
  4.         verticalAlign="middle"
  5.         backgroundColor="white">
  6.  
  7.     <mx:Script>
  8.         <![CDATA[
  9.             private function init():void {
  10.                 slider.value = slider.getStyle("dataTipOffset");
  11.             }
  12.         ]]>
  13.     </mx:Script>
  14.  
  15.     <mx:Form>
  16.         <mx:FormItem label="dataTipOffset:" direction="horizontal">
  17.             <mx:HSlider id="slider"
  18.                     minimum="-10"
  19.                     maximum="30"
  20.                     snapInterval="1"
  21.                     tickInterval="5"
  22.                     liveDragging="true"
  23.                     dataTipOffset="{slider.value}"
  24.                     dataTipPrecision="0"
  25.                     showTrackHighlight="true"
  26.                     initialize="init();" />
  27.             <mx:Label text="{slider.value}" width="30" />
  28.         </mx:FormItem>
  29.     </mx:Form>
  30.  
  31. </mx:Application>
代码:Peter deHaan 翻译/整理/编译:minidxer

Topics: Flex | No Comments » | 49 views Tags: , , , ,

Related Post

Leave a Comment

Name(*):

E-Mail(*) :

Website :

Comments :

Search Posts

赞助商链接

Archives